Description

Segmentation regulation formula ergonomic chair
Technical Field
The utility model relates to the field of office furniture, in particular to a sectional adjustment type ergonomic chair.
Background
An office chair is a variety of chairs which are convenient to work in daily work and social activities, a common office chair is a backrest chair on which a person sits when working on a desktop in a sitting posture state, a traditional office chair is usually provided with casters and an air compression rod, so that the chair can be conveniently moved and the height of the chair can be conveniently adjusted, but a user still feels tired after the common office chair is used for a long time, so in recent years, an office chair specially designed for a human body curve structure is developed to adapt to the sitting posture of a human body, the sitting comfort is improved, and the use fatigue is reduced.
The applicant finds that the seat cushions of the existing office chairs are always of fixed structures, the gravity center is positioned at the hip when a human body is in an sit-up state, and the gravity center is transferred to the thigh when the user lies over a table, because the seat cushion of the common chair is of a fixed structure and can not be adjusted along with the change of the gravity center, the stress is uneven, the weight of a human body is concentrated at the buttocks or the thighs for a long time, the fatigue and the ache are easy to generate, the comfort level and the use flexibility are lower, meanwhile, the existing office chair backrest is often of an integral structure, or simply divided into a plurality of parts such as the waist, the back and the head, and the back curve of the human body is determined by 26 large segmented skeletons of the spine, so that the common chair has too few segments, can not adjust a proper curve according to people with different heights and body types, has lower applicability, and the transverse curvature of the backrest is often a fixed structure, which is difficult to adjust specifically according to the back curve of the user.

Referring to fig. 1 to 3, as an embodiment of the present invention, a sectional-adjustment type ergonomic chair includes: the left side and the right side of the chair seat 1 are both provided with mutually parallel sliding chutes 2; the seat cushion balancing mechanism 3 is arranged on the inner side of the sliding chute 2; a backrest support rod 4 rotatably provided at the rear side of the seat 1; the backrest adjusting mechanism 5 is arranged on the backrest support rod 4; the curvature adjusting mechanism 6 is arranged on the backrest adjusting mechanism 5; the backrest support sheet 7 is arranged on the curvature adjusting mechanism 6; wherein, the backrest support sheet 7 is provided with a plurality of pieces along the axial direction of the backrest support bar 4.
Referring to fig. 3 to 5, optionally, the seat cushion balancing mechanism 3 includes a sliding seat 301 and a balancing rotating shaft 302 connected to the inner side of the sliding seat 301, the sliding seat 301 is disposed at the inner side of the sliding slot 2, a seat cushion 303 is connected to the middle of the balancing rotating shaft 302, the seat cushion 303 can rotate on the sliding seat 301 through the balancing rotating shaft 302 to adjust the balance, when the human body is in the sit-up state, the center of gravity is located at the hip, the seat cushion 303 can rotate backward through the balancing rotating shaft 302 to adjust the pressure, so that the pressure is evenly distributed to the hip and the thigh when the human body is in a lying work, the center of gravity is transferred to the thigh, the seat cushion 303 can rotate forward through the balancing rotating shaft 302 to adjust the pressure, so that the stress is prevented from being uneven, the weight of the human body is concentrated on the hip or the thigh for a long time, meanwhile, the sliding seat 301 can horizontally move in the sliding groove 2, so that the front and rear positions of the seat cushion 303 can be adjusted, and the use flexibility and the applicability of the device can be improved.
Referring to fig. 6 to 7, optionally, the backrest adjusting mechanism 5 includes a fixing sleeve 501 and a locking button 502 disposed in the middle of the fixing sleeve 501, the fixing sleeve 501 is nested on the backrest support rod 4 and can move to adjust the position on the backrest support rod 4, a horizontal sleeve 503 is disposed on the outer side of the fixing sleeve 501, a horizontal strut 504 is nested in the horizontal sleeve 503 and can move to adjust the position in the horizontal sleeve 503, the backrest support plate 7 is connected to the horizontal strut 504 of the backrest adjusting mechanism 5 through the curvature adjusting mechanism 6, so that the height and the front and back positions of the backrest support plate 7 can be adjusted through the backrest adjusting mechanism 5, the height interval and the front and back positions of each section of the backrest support plate 7 can be adjusted to adapt to the back curves of users with different body types, and the use comfort is improved, the use flexibility and the applicability of the device are improved.
Referring to fig. 8, optionally, the curvature adjusting mechanism 6 includes a central seat 601, the central seat 601 is connected to one end of the horizontal strut 504, the backrest support plate 7 is disposed in the middle of the central seat 601, an adjusting screw 602 is disposed at the other end of the horizontal strut 504, adjusting knobs 603 are disposed at both ends of the adjusting screw 602, adjusting nuts 604 are symmetrically disposed at both sides of the adjusting screw 602, the adjusting nuts 604 are nested outside the adjusting screw 602, a nut rotating shaft 605 is disposed at one side of the adjusting nut 604, an adjusting link 606 is connected to the inner side of the nut rotating shaft 605, one end of the adjusting link 606 is connected to the adjusting nut 604 through the nut rotating shaft 605, the other end of the adjusting link 606 is connected to the backrest support plate 7 through the link rotating shaft 607, and the side surface of the backrest support plate 7 is a concave surface for being convenient to fit to the back of a human body, meanwhile, the backrest support sheet 7 is made of elastic materials and can be bent and adjusted to a certain degree, the adjusting knob 603 is rotated to drive the adjusting screw 602 to rotate, so that the adjusting screw sleeve 604 is driven to horizontally move on the adjusting screw 602, the backrest support sheet 7 is driven to contract inwards to reduce the curvature or expand outwards to increase the curvature by adjusting the connecting rod 606 and the connecting rod rotating shaft 607, the curvature of the backrest support sheet 7 is adjusted, the backrest support sheet is suitable for back curves of users with different body types, the use comfort degree is improved, and the use flexibility and the applicability of the device are improved.
Referring to fig. 1 to 2 again, optionally, a headrest 8 is disposed at an upper end of the backrest support bar 7 for supporting a head of a user, a correction belt 9 is disposed at one side of the backrest support bar 7, the correction belt 9 can attach a back of the user to the backrest support bar 7 to prevent incorrect sitting posture, a plurality of backrest support bars 7 are disposed along an axial direction of the backrest support bar 4, each backrest support bar 7 can adjust a height interval and a front-back position by the backrest adjustment mechanism 5, and adjust a curvature by the curvature adjustment mechanism 6, so that the more the number of the backrest support bars 7 is, the more delicate the adjustment is, the more suitable the back curve of the human body is, the higher the comfort level and the applicability are, and correspondingly, the higher the manufacturing cost is, the more inconvenient the adjustment is, the less the number of the backrest support bars 7 is, the lower the manufacturing cost is, the adjustment is more convenient, accordingly, the back support plate 7 is not finely adjusted, is difficult to adapt to the back curve of the human body, and has lower use comfort and applicability, so that the number of the back support plates 7 which are arranged in a segmented mode is optimized from 15 to 30 sections, and the number of the movable bones of the spine of the human body is 26 sections which are equal to the number of the movable bones of the spine of the human body.
When the device is used, the main body structure of the device is supported by the seat 1, when a human body sits, the sliding seat 301 can horizontally move in the sliding groove 2, so that the front and back positions of the seat cushion 303 are adjusted, meanwhile, the adjusting knob 603 can be rotated to drive the adjusting screw 602 to rotate, so that the adjusting screw 604 is driven to horizontally move on the adjusting screw 602, the adjusting connecting rod 606 and the connecting rod rotating shaft 607 drive the backrest supporting sheet 7 to contract inwards to reduce the curvature or expand outwards to increase the curvature, so that the curvature of the backrest supporting sheet 7 is adjusted to adapt to the back curves of users with different body types, the fixing clamping sleeve 501 is vertically moved on the backrest supporting rod 4 to adjust the height and the front and back positions of the backrest 7, the height interval and the front and back positions of each section of the backrest supporting sheet 7 are adjusted to adapt to the back curves of users with different body types, when the adjustment is, the device supports a human body through a seat cushion 303, the seat cushion 303 can rotate on a sliding seat 301 through a balance rotating shaft 302 to adjust balance, when the human body is in an sit-up state, the gravity center is positioned at the hip, the seat cushion 303 can rotate backwards through the balance rotating shaft 302 to adjust pressure, so that the pressure is uniformly distributed to the hip and the thigh, when the human body works at a desk, the gravity center can be transferred to the thigh, the seat cushion 303 can rotate forwards through the balance rotating shaft 302 to adjust pressure, so that the pressure is uniformly distributed to the hip and the thigh, thereby preventing uneven stress, the weight of the human body is concentrated at the hip or the thigh for a long time, avoiding fatigue and ache, meanwhile, a plurality of sections of backrest support sheets 7 correspond to the vertebra of the human body one by one, are fully attached to the back of the human body, a headrest 8 supports the head of the user, a belt 9 can be, prevent the back of the passenger from not fitting the back support plates 7 with each other due to incorrect sitting posture.
